CVE-2024-39376

Improper Access Control In TELSAT MarKoni FM Transmitter

Description

TELSAT marKoni FM Transmitters are vulnerable to users gaining unauthorized access to sensitive information or performing actions beyond their designated permissions.

Remediation

Solution:

  • Markoni has released the following version to remediate these vulnerabilities: TELSAT marKoni FM Transmitter: Version 2.0.1. For more information, contact Markoni https://www.markoni.it/contacts/ .
